لينكس

كيفية تثبيت GNU nano واستخدامه لتحرير الملفات على Linux

إذا كنت تبدأ رحلتك مع Linux، فإن إنشاء الملفات وتحريرها يعد أحد الأشياء المهمة التي ستقوم بها، وخاصة إذا كنت تخطط لإتقان برمجة shell scripting. يعد GNU nano أحد أكثر محررات النصوص شيوعًا على Linux، والذي يأتي مثبتًا مسبقًا على معظم توزيعات Linux الحديثة.




يدعم برنامج nano ميزات حيوية مثل تمييز بناء الجملة، وإكمال النص، والتحقق من التهجئة، وغير ذلك، وهو مناسب للمبتدئين، على عكس البدائل الغنية بالميزات مثل Vim وEmacs. إليك كيفية تثبيت GNU nano واستخدامه للعمل مع الملفات على Linux.


كيفية تثبيت GNU nano على Linux

اعتمادًا على توزيع Linux الخاص بك، قد يكون nano مثبتًا مسبقًا. افتح المحطة الطرفية وقم بتشغيل نانو –الإصدار الأمر للتحقق مما إذا كان الأمر كذلك. إذا استجاب سطر الأوامر برقم الإصدار، فهذا يعني أن لديك nano مثبتًا.

عرض إصدار GNU nano في المحطة الطرفية

إذا لم يكن الأمر كذلك، فأنت بحاجة إلى تثبيت nano. هناك طرق مختلفة للقيام بذلك. ومع ذلك، فإن استخدام مدير الحزم الافتراضي لسطر الأوامر هو الطريقة الأسرع والأسهل على الإطلاق (وهو أحد الأسباب التي تجعل Linux يحب استخدام سطر الأوامر).


على ديبيان/أوبونتو

إذا كنت تستخدم نظام Debian أو Ubuntu، فافتح محطة Linux وقم بتشغيل sudo apt تحديث. بعد ذلك قم بتشغيل:

sudo apt install nano 

جري
sudo apt تحديث
يُنصح بشدة بمراجعة دليل البرامج قبل تثبيت الحزم، ولكن هذا ليس إلزاميًا. فهو يضمن تحديث فهرس الحزمة المحلي لديك ومزامنته مع المستودعات البعيدة. وهذا يساعد في منع المشكلات المحتملة مثل تثبيت حزم قديمة أو غير متوافقة.

على RHEL/CentOS

يجري sudo yum تثبيت نانو لتثبيت GNU nano على توزيعات Linux المستندة إلى RPM. في الأنظمة الأحدث التي تم استبدال YUM فيها بمدير الحزم DNF، قم بتشغيل:

sudo dnf install nano 

ويعمل الأخير أيضًا مع Fedora.

أقرأ ايضا  استمع إلى الراديو عبر الإنترنت من محطة Linux الخاصة بك باستخدام PyRadio

على Arch Linux

لتثبيت GNU nano على توزيعات Linux المستندة إلى Arch، قم بتشغيل:

sudo pacman -S nano 

كيفية فتح GNU nano والخروج منه

تم الآن تثبيت محرر النصوص nano، ولكن كيف يمكنك فتحه؟

افتح محطة لينكس وقم بتشغيل نانوسيتم فتح ملف nano في المحطة الطرفية، مما يسمح لك بإنشاء ملف جديد.

محرر النصوص GNU nano مفتوح


للخروج اضغط على السيطرة + Xسيتم إغلاق المحرر على الفور. ومع ذلك، إذا قمت بإدخال بعض النص في الملف الفارغ، فسوف يسألك nano عما إذا كنت ترغب في حفظ التغييرات أولاً.

إذا كنت لا تريد حفظ التغييرات، اضغط على ن للخروج من المحرر على الفور. وإلا، اضغط على يأدخل اسم الملف (على سبيل المثال، مثال.txt)، ثم اضغط يدخل للخروج.

كيفية التعامل مع الملفات في GNU nano

إن العمل مع الملفات هو الوظيفة الأساسية التي ستستخدم برنامج nano من أجلها. فأنت بحاجة إلى معرفة كيفية فتح الملفات وإنشاء ملفات جديدة ونسخها وقصها ولصقها وحتى حفظ التغييرات. وبمجرد إتقان هذه الأساسيات، سيكون استخدام برنامج nano أسهل في المستقبل.

فتح الملفات في النانو

لفتح ملف موجود في برنامج nano، يجب أن تعرف اسم الملف وامتداده. قد يبدو هذا واضحًا، لكنه أمر بالغ الأهمية لأن برنامج nano سيفترض أنك ترغب في إنشاء ملف جديد إذا لم تدخل الاسم الصحيح بالامتداد الصحيح.


بعد ذلك، يتعين عليك أيضًا الانتقال إلى الموقع الدقيق الذي يوجد به الملف من سطر أوامر Linux. بعد ذلك، قم بتنفيذ هذا الأمر لفتح الملف:

nano filename.extension 
برنامج نصي bash مفتوح في GNU nano

على سبيل المثال، إذا كنت تريد فتح example.txt، قم بتشغيل:

nano example.txt 

تذكر أن أسماء الملفات حساسة لحالة الأحرف.

أقرأ ايضا  كيفية تثبيت بايثون في أوبونتو [3.12]

إنشاء الملفات وتحريرها والتنقل خلالها

في nano، يمكنك إنشاء ملف بطريقتين. يمكنك تحديد اسم الملف باستخدام نانو يمكنك استخدام الأمر أو البدء بفتح المحرر أولاً، ثم حفظ التغييرات وتحديد اسم الملف. لا يهم الطريقة التي تختار استخدامها لأنك ستظل تؤكد اسم الملف أثناء حفظ التغييرات.


لإنشاء ملف في nano، قم بتشغيل:

nano filename.extension 

سيتم فتح برنامج nano بملف نصي فارغ. بدلاً من ذلك، قم بتشغيل نانو أمر لفتح nano في الوضع الفارغ أولاً.

تحرير الملفات في nano ليس معقدًا أيضًا. اكتب ما تريد، ثم اضغط على يدخل لبدء سطر جديد. إذا كنت بحاجة إلى القفز إلى بداية أو نهاية سطر، فاضغط على السيطرة + أ أو السيطرة + Eعلى التوالى.

هناك طريقة أخرى للتنقل بسهولة عبر ملف في nano وهي استخدام السيطرة + V للانتقال إلى نهاية الملف أو السيطرة + ي للانتقال إلى البداية. إذا كان لديك ملف كبير يمتد على عدة صفحات، السيطرة + ي سيتم التمرير إلى أعلى الصفحة السيطرة + V صفحة واحدة لأسفل.

البحث عن مصطلحات محددة في ملف

ميزة البحث عن النص في GNU nano


للبحث عن نص محدد داخل ملف، استخدم Ctrl + Wثم أدخل مصطلح البحث. بشكل افتراضي، سيأخذك nano فقط إلى أول نتيجة مطابقة، والتي سيتم تمييزها. ومع ذلك، يمكنك البحث في الملف بالكامل للعثور على حالات أخرى للمصطلح باستخدام البديل + دبليو أو الخيار + W (إذا كنت تقوم بتشغيل Linux على جهاز Mac).

البحث عن النص واستبداله

يمكنك أيضًا البحث عن نص واستبداله في nano، وهو أمر مفيد عندما تحتاج إلى استبدال عدة حالات من مصطلح معين دون المرور يدويًا على الملف بالكامل. للقيام بذلك، اضغط على السيطرة + \سيطلب منك nano إدخال كلمة ترغب في استبدالها. أدخل المصطلح، ثم اضغط على يدخل.

بعد ذلك، قم بتوفير مصطلح بديل واضغط على يدخلإذا كان هناك أكثر من تكرار للمصطلح المراد استبداله في الملف، فيجب عليك تحديد ما إذا كنت ترغب في استبدال التكرار الأول أو كل التكرارات. اضغط على ي ليحل محل المثال الأول أو أ لاستبدال كافة تكرارات المصطلح الذي تم البحث عنه.


البحث عن نص واستبداله في ملف باستخدام محرر النصوص GNU nano

أقرأ ايضا  كيفية الوصول إلى ملفات Linux على iOS وAndroid باستخدام Network Share

نسخ وقص ولصق النص في nano

لنسخ النص في nano، انتقل إلى النص المحدد الذي تريد نسخه وضع المؤشر في البداية. بعد ذلك، اضغط على ألت + أ أو الخيار + أ لتشغيل أداة تحديد النص في nano. ثم اضغط على مفتاح السهم للأمام (>) على لوحة المفاتيح الخاصة بك حتى يتم تغطية كل النص الذي تريد نسخه بخلفية بيضاء.

تحديد النص المراد نسخه أو قصه في محرر النصوص GNU nano

يضعط ألت + 6 لنسخ النص أو السيطرة + ك للقص. انتقل إلى الموقع الذي ترغب في وضع النص المنسوخ أو المقطوع فيه واضغط على السيطرة + U للصق.


حفظ تغييرات الملف والخروج من nano

بمجرد الانتهاء من العمل على ملف، احفظه بالضغط على السيطرة + O. تأكد من أنك تقوم بالحفظ في الملف الصحيح بالضغط على يدخل.

إذا كنت ترغب في حفظ التغييرات في ملف مختلف، فقم بتغيير اسم الملف إلى اسم آخر قبل النقر فوق يدخل. بعد ذلك، قم بالخروج من nano بالضغط على السيطرة + X.

العمل بكفاءة مع ملفات Linux باستخدام GNU nano

GNU nano هو محرر نصوص بسيط وسهل الاستخدام للمبتدئين على Linux. فهو يحتوي على ميزات كافية لتسهيل العمل مع الملفات من سطر الأوامر دون إغراقك بالعديد من الوظائف التي لا تحتاج إليها كمبتدئ.

من خلال إتقان النصائح المذكورة أعلاه، فإن استخدام GNU nano سيجعل تجربة Linux الخاصة بك أفضل عند العمل مع الملفات من سطر الأوامر.

التعليمات

س: لماذا لا يعمل الأمر nano على Linux؟

إذا واجهت أخطاء أثناء تشغيل GNU nano، فمن المحتمل أن يكون البرنامج غير مثبت بشكل صحيح على جهازك أو أنه غير مثبت على الإطلاق. حاول اتباع خطوات التثبيت مرة أخرى ولاحظ ما إذا كان الخطأ لا يزال قائمًا. تأكد أيضًا من عدم ارتكاب أي أخطاء مطبعية أثناء إصدار الأمر.


س: أين يتم تثبيت GNU nano على Linux؟

لعرض المسار الذي يتم تخزين ملف GNU nano الثنائي فيه، استخدم الأمرين which أو whereis. سيعرض الناتج المسار الدقيق لملف GNU nano الثنائي.

whereis nano
which nano

إذا لم تحصل على نتيجة، فهذا يعني أنك لا تملك GNU nano مثبتًا على جهاز الكمبيوتر الذي يعمل بنظام Linux الخاص بك.

س: كيفية تشغيل GNU nano في الخلفية في لينكس؟

لتشغيل GNU nano في الخلفية، أضف ببساطة & في نهاية الأمر nano. على سبيل المثال:

nano filename.txt & 

هناك طريقة أخرى وهي تشغيل الأمر nano أولاً، ثم الضغط على السيطرة + Z لإيقاف العملية، ثم اكتب الخلفية في المحطة الطرفية لإرسال nano إلى الخلفية. توجد أيضًا طرق أخرى لتشغيل أوامر Linux في الخلفية، وستعمل مع GNU nano أيضًا.


اكتشاف المزيد من موقع قلم ورقم

اشترك للحصول على أحدث التدوينات في بريدك الإلكتروني.

اترك رد

زر الذهاب إلى الأعلى

اكتشاف المزيد من موقع قلم ورقم

اشترك الآن للاستمرار في القراءة والحصول على حق الوصول إلى الأرشيف الكامل.

Continue reading

أنت تستخدم إضافة Adblock

لكي تتمكن من قراءة المقال يرجى ازالة مانع الاعلانات لديك واعمل تحديث للصفحة.